Case of necrotizing fasciitis in a healthy 37-year-old male.
-
2
Caused by Group A Streptococcus after minor trauma.
-
3
Initial misdiagnosis included testicular torsion and dermatitis.
-
4
Treatment involved fasciotomy and intravenous antibiotics.
-
5
Research highlights importance of early recognition and treatment.
-
6
Patient fully recovered with no organ dysfunction post-treatment.
